Innovation in Concrete Production: ProAll Reimer P85/25 Ultra Mobile Concrete Plant
Revolutionary Technology
The ProAll Reimer P85/25 is renowned for its ability to produce high-quality concrete on-site. This mobile concrete batching plant enables the mixing of certified concrete directly at the construction site, leading to significant time and cost savings. This approach eliminates the need for long transport times of concrete, which often leads to logistical complications and delays.
Benefits of On-Site Concrete Production
The ability to produce certified concrete on-site offers several advantages:
- Freshness: The concrete is always freshly mixed, enhancing its quality and performance.
- Customization: Mix ratios can be adjusted on-the-fly to meet specific project requirements.
- Eco-Friendliness: Less transport means a lower carbon footprint, contributing to more sustainable construction practices.
- Cost Savings: Reduction in transport and material wastage results in direct cost savings.
